The global indoor training bike market is experiencing robust growth, driven by the increasing popularity of fitness and wellness activities, coupled with the convenience and accessibility of home-based workouts. The market, segmented by application (commercial and household) and type (exercise bike and spinning bike), is projected to witness significant expansion over the forecast period (2025-2033). While precise figures for market size and CAGR are not provided, a reasonable estimation based on industry trends suggests a current market size of approximately $5 billion in 2025,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 8% projected through 2033. This growth is fueled by several factors, including rising disposable incomes in developing economies, increasing health awareness, and technological advancements leading to more engaging and feature-rich indoor cycling experiences. The household segment is expected to dominate, driven by the growing preference for home fitness solutions, and the spinning bike type is projected to witness faster growth due to its higher perceived intensity and engagement compared to traditional exercise bikes.
Major players like Peloton, Nautilus, and Precor are significantly contributing to market expansion through innovative product launches, strategic partnerships, and robust marketing campaigns. However, challenges remain, including potential price sensitivity among consumers, competition from other fitness equipment, and the need for continuous innovation to maintain market share in a dynamic and competitive landscape. Regional growth will vary, with North America and Europe maintaining significant market share due to higher fitness awareness and disposable incomes. However, Asia-Pacific is poised for rapid expansion due to its burgeoning middle class and growing adoption of fitness trends. The market’s future success will hinge on continued technological enhancements, creative marketing strategies, and the ability of manufacturers to cater to diverse consumer preferences and needs, encompassing both budget-conscious and premium-focused segments.
The global indoor training bike market is a moderately concentrated industry, with a few major players capturing a significant portion of the overall revenue. Estimates suggest that the top 10 companies account for approximately 60-70% of the market share, valued at over $3 billion annually based on a global market size of roughly $5 billion in 2023. This concentration is primarily driven by brand recognition, established distribution networks, and technological advancements. However, the market is also characterized by a significant number of smaller niche players catering to specific segments, like boutique studios or high-end home fitness enthusiasts.

Impact of Regulations:
Safety regulations concerning bike stability, material composition, and electrical components impact manufacturers' designs and costs. These regulations, while necessary, can increase manufacturing complexities and potentially raise prices.
Product Substitutes:
Other forms of cardio equipment (treadmills, elliptical trainers) and outdoor cycling compete for consumer preference. Technological advancements and marketing efforts by indoor training bike manufacturers are essential to maintain market share.
End User Concentration:
The market is divided between commercial users (gyms, studios) and household users. The household market is showing significant growth, fueled by the increasing adoption of home fitness solutions.
Level of M&A:
Consolidation within the market is likely as larger companies acquire smaller innovative players to broaden their product lines and enhance their technological capabilities. The next 5 years are expected to see a moderate level of mergers and acquisitions.
The indoor training bike market is experiencing dynamic growth, driven by several key trends:
The rise of connected fitness has revolutionized the industry. Integration with apps and platforms offering interactive workouts, personalized training plans, and community features have made indoor cycling more engaging and effective. The demand for at-home fitness solutions, further accelerated by the COVID-19 pandemic, has propelled the sales of indoor training bikes, transforming the home workout experience. Consumers now have access to a diverse range of price points, from budget-friendly models to premium, feature-rich options. Furthermore, increasing health consciousness among individuals, coupled with a growing preference for convenient and personalized fitness regimes, has added significant momentum to the market. Advanced features like AI-powered coaching, real-time performance feedback, and gamification are making indoor cycling increasingly appealing to a broader audience. Sustainable materials and eco-friendly manufacturing processes are also gaining traction, reflecting a growing concern for environmental impact. While the connected fitness segment is currently the fastest-growing, the market will see future growth through expansion into untapped regions and markets, focusing on developing economies where fitness awareness is rising, with a simultaneous push towards increased affordability through innovative manufacturing techniques and supply chain optimization. We anticipate an evolution toward more personalized and adaptive training experiences, potentially integrated with other health data and devices to offer a holistic wellness solution. This focus on customization and data-driven insights will drive innovation and ultimately market growth in the years ahead. The introduction of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ies to indoor cycling enhances the user experience, offering a more engaging and immersive workout environment.
The household use segment is poised to dominate the indoor training bike market in the coming years.
High Growth Potential: The increasing adoption of home fitness solutions, coupled with the convenience and personalized experience offered by indoor training bikes, is fueling significant growth within the household segment.
Market Penetration: While commercial gyms and fitness studios remain important customers, the accessibility and affordability of indoor training bikes are driving higher market penetration into homes.
Technological Advancements: The incorporation of smart technology, including connectivity and app integration, is particularly appealing to the home fitness market.
Geographic Distribution: Growth in this segment is observed across various regions, with particularly strong performance in North America, Europe, and parts of Asia Pacific, where disposable incomes and awareness of health and fitness are high.
North America: This region currently holds the largest market share, attributed to higher disposable incomes, increasing health consciousness, and early adoption of connected fitness technologies. The United States, in particular, is a significant driver of market growth due to its robust home fitness market.
Europe: Countries such as Germany, the United Kingdom, and France represent strong markets for indoor training bikes. Growing awareness of health benefits and a rising preference for home-based workouts are contributing to the expansion of this sector in Europe.
Asia Pacific: While North America and Europe are currently leading, the Asia Pacific region displays high growth potential due to the expanding middle class, rising disposable incomes, and increasing awareness of health and fitness. Countries like China, India, and Japan are expected to witness significant market expansion in the coming years.

The indoor training bike market is propelled by several key factors: the increasing popularity of home fitness solutions and the convenience they provide; technological advancements resulting in more engaging and personalized workouts; rising health consciousness and the growing awareness of the importance of regular exercise; and the expansion of connected fitness platforms, which offer interactive classes, virtual races, and community features.
Challenges include the relatively high initial cost of some models, competition from other forms of exercise equipment, potential concerns about long-term durability, and the need to manage evolving consumer preferences and technological advancements. Maintaining consistent product innovation and effective marketing strategies are crucial to address these challenges.
Emerging trends include the increasing integration of artificial intelligence for personalized training programs, the use of virtual reality and augmented reality to create more immersive workout experiences, and the growing focus on sustainable and eco-friendly manufacturing processes. The adoption of these trends will influence future market dynamics.
